Another step towards animal protection

The need for coordinated action is evident as, since January 1, 2020, 88 cases of animal abuse have been registered in the capital city. During this time, Budapest police officers and their collaborating partners have saved over 200 animals.

The EU TalentOn is open for entries

What is the EU TalentOn?   It is a new contest especially developed for early career researchers. Young ambitious researchers working together on challenges related to the five EU Missions. In Leiden, European City of Science 2022, the researchers will be working on solutions for climate adaptation, beating cancer, smart cities, and achieving healthy soils and waters. This pressure cooker event takes place in Leiden coming September. Techlab Hackathon – great success for Students of the University of Veterinary Medicine Budapest   The Hungarian Chamber of Agriculture’s Techlab Hackathon competition was held recently at Moholy-Nagy University of Art and Design. The programme’s long-term goal is to modernize and digitalize agriculture.
